|
Senior MCU Embedded Firmware Engineer
# \$ S5 L5 X' t) T5 N' G# F' S
9 p: _" U2 o* x: Y1 Z公 司:A famous IC company
4 U6 h Z9 _ v' d2 w$ N9 N工作地点:上海
; y. s/ W3 p/ i
% {" u2 z4 y$ PResponsibilities M5 I8 d9 M. o5 q/ ]/ H
Develop software examples for the peripherals of the MCU products.
- B$ ?" i1 G1 Z& @: H4 U6 \Develop middleware frameworks for ARM MCU products and their complicate peripherals/functions such as USB, Ethernet, MCI, User Interface, Touch Screen, etc., D" a1 ]" s2 d3 t; ?, F1 H2 D
Write application notes or technical articles , F0 w" X e, f% Z; E
Participate in customer support or training of software solutions : B. s; D9 d* H! b3 P/ Y$ B0 U
Involve in application level software design and development for various reference designs
8 m& A/ h- c! a6 D
9 v* C9 Q: l) b9 e: z9 y1 jMandatory Skills
& m% o% X) \/ H! hMust have a proven experience in development in C on embedded systems based on microcontrollers, assembler is an add-on.
! v/ T g" Q6 jMust have knowledge of one or more communication protocols. (such as USB, Ethernet, Industry Field Bus etc.)6 h) }6 k% o" C
Must have a proven experience in software development flow (version control, bug tracking, software delivery, coding standard?. Software Development Project Management experience is a plus.
" D! c$ o9 `# p8 V2 GMust communicate fluently in English, either by reading, writing or speaking. ; n+ T( B$ W8 Z$ z, V Q
6 A M& p E# s" OPreferred Skills
6 `3 S# U" T) n" |) Q" A4 R, zPreferred to have a proven experience in designing drivers for several kinds of peripherals under RTOS, such as FreeRTOS, uCOS-II, eCOS, etc.
9 P/ m, x& c2 I& iPreferred experience in middleware development. 9 L$ H. U1 n j0 b9 f: S
Preferred experience in software testing. ' w1 o- h6 c( l
Preferred experience in wireless protocols, such as Zigbee, Wifi etc.
/ B. h; z- }; h: J8 q, e- ~Preferred working experience in ARM based systems. `/ Q5 v. I7 S! {* q: }& e
9 ?4 O0 }1 ^( Q% NEducation # R+ [, N) J+ R$ X3 n; A: K
Bachelor or Master Degree of Electrical Engineering or Computer Science
8 L. P# l& t! k- F' x' D" q& [! d9 v8 m, v p+ X
Experience
+ g, B3 k5 m* s# L, o8 D7+ years of working experience in the high-tech industry.
* q0 _% k+ ^" W5+ years of experience in embedded firmware development 3 L/ L7 Q; P) F
3+ years of experience in an US or Europe based company |
|